Bengals signing former 49ers WR Trent Taylor

Bengals signing former 49ers WR Trent Taylor

By David Bonilla
May 17, 2021

The Cincinnati Bengals are signing former San Francisco 49ers wide receiver Trent Taylor, per Mike Garafolo of NFL Network. Taylor tried out for his new team during a rookie minicamp over the weekend. #Bengals are signing former #49ers slot receiver and punt returner Trent...
